In recent years, the worlds of Computer vision, Blockchain technology, and gaming have been increasingly converging to create innovative and immersive experiences for players. This fusion has paved the way for the development of blockchain games that leverage computer vision technology to enhance the daily gaming experience. Computer vision, a branch of artificial intelligence that enables machines to interpret and understand visual information from the real world, has found numerous applications in the gaming industry. Through advanced algorithms and image recognition techniques, computer vision allows games to incorporate elements of the physical world into virtual environments, blurring the lines between reality and digital simulations. Blockchain technology, on the other hand, introduces a new paradigm of decentralization, security, and transparency to the gaming ecosystem. By leveraging blockchain technology, game developers can create decentralized gaming platforms where players have true ownership of in-game assets and can participate in secure peer-to-peer transactions. When computer vision and blockchain technology come together in the context of gaming, the possibilities are endless. Imagine a scenario where a player's real-world movements and gestures are captured and translated into in-game actions through computer vision algorithms. These actions are then securely recorded on a blockchain network, ensuring transparency and immutability. For example, a blockchain game could utilize computer vision technology to track a player's physical activity and reward them with in-game assets based on their performance. This not only incentivizes players to stay active but also creates a unique gaming experience that seamlessly blends the digital and physical realms. Moreover, the integration of computer vision and blockchain technology in daily gaming can lead to the creation of personalized gaming experiences tailored to individual players. By analyzing players' behavior and preferences through computer vision algorithms, game developers can offer customized challenges, rewards, and content, fostering a deeper engagement and connection with the game. In conclusion, the convergence of computer vision and blockchain technology in the realm of gaming holds immense potential to transform the way we experience and interact with games on a daily basis. As these technologies continue to evolve and intertwine, we can expect to see a new era of gaming experiences that are not only immersive and engaging but also personalized and secure.
